 43/dts-v1/;
 44#include "sun5i-a13.dtsi"
 45#include "sunxi-common-regulators.dtsi"
 46
 47#include <dt-bindings/gpio/gpio.h>
 48#include <dt-bindings/input/input.h>
 49
 50/ {
 51	model = "HSG H702";
 52	compatible = "hsg,h702", "allwinner,sun5i-a13";
 53
 54	aliases {
 55		serial0 = &uart1;
 56	};
 57
 58	chosen {
 59		stdout-path = "serial0:115200n8";
 60	};
 61};
 62
 63&cpu0 {
 64	cpu-supply = <&reg_dcdc2>;
 65};
 66
 67&ehci0 {
 68	status = "okay";
 69};
 70
 71&i2c0 {
 72	status = "okay";
 73
 74	axp209: pmic@34 {
 75		reg = <0x34>;
 76		interrupts = <0>;
 77	};
 78};
 79
 80&i2c1 {
 81	status = "okay";
 82
 83	pcf8563: rtc@51 {
 84		compatible = "nxp,pcf8563";
 85		reg = <0x51>;
 86	};
 87};
 88
 89&i2c2 {
 90	status = "okay";
 91};
 92
 93&lradc {
 94	vref-supply = <&reg_ldo2>;
 95	status = "okay";
 96
 97	button-200 {
 98		label = "Volume Up";
 99		linux,code = <KEY_VOLUMEUP>;
100		channel = <0>;
101		voltage = <200000>;
102	};
103
104	button-400 {
105		label = "Volume Down";
106		linux,code = <KEY_VOLUMEDOWN>;
107		channel = <0>;
108		voltage = <400000>;
109	};
110};
111
112&mmc0 {
113	vmmc-supply = <&reg_vcc3v3>;
114	bus-width = <4>;
115	cd-gpios = <&pio 6 0 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* PG0 */
116	status = "okay";
117};
118
119&ohci0 {
120	status = "okay";
121};
122
123&otg_sram {
124	status = "okay";
125};
126
127#include "axp209.dtsi"
128
129&reg_dcdc2 {
130	regulator-always-on;
131	regulator-min-microvolt = <1000000>;
132	regulator-max-microvolt = <1500000>;
133	regulator-name = "vdd-cpu";
134};
135
136&reg_dcdc3 {
137	regulator-always-on;
138	regulator-min-microvolt = <1000000>;
139	regulator-max-microvolt = <1400000>;
140	regulator-name = "vdd-int-dll";
141};
142
143&reg_ldo1 {
144	regulator-name = "vdd-rtc";
145};
146
147&reg_ldo2 {
148	regulator-always-on;
149	regulator-min-microvolt = <3000000>;
150	regulator-max-microvolt = <3000000>;
151	regulator-name = "avcc";
152};
153
154&reg_ldo3 {
155	regulator-min-microvolt = <3300000>;
156	reg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
157	regulator-name = "vcc-wifi";
158};
159
160&reg_usb0_vbus {
161	gpio = <&pio 6 12 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>; /* PG12 */
162	status = "okay";
163};
164
165&uart1 {
166	pinctrl-names = "default";
167	pinctrl-0 = <&uart1_pg_pins>;
168	status = "okay";
169};
170
171&usb_otg {
172	dr_mode = "otg";
173	status = "okay";
174};
175
176&usbphy {
177	usb0_id_det-gpios = <&pio 6 2 (G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H | GPIO_PULL_UP)>; /* PG2 */
178	usb0_vbus_det-gpios = <&pio 6 1 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>; /* PG1 */
179	usb0_vbus-supply = <&reg_usb0_vbus>;
180	usb1_vbus-supply = <&reg_ldo3>;
181	status = "okay";
182};
